The Reef-Rat, although still in development, is much easier to build. The big problem is the torque required to swivel the nozzle. The water rocketing out of the return pipe exerts quite a load on that pivoting nozzle. Needs more work prior to release. ![]() Quote:
These motors typically have a 4 or 5 watt rating. As it is many Sea-Swirls had a failing motor problem, part due to heat and part due to motor rating and size, they work hard and wear out after a while. Probably easier just to add a modified sch40 nozzle fitting on the return nozzle. Van
